Pianiga, Veneto, Italy

Overview

Pianiga is a charming small town in the Veneto region of northern Italy, known for its peaceful pace, local hospitality, and picturesque rural surroundings. Conveniently located between Venice and Padua, it offers a genuine taste of small-town Italian life with easy access to larger cities.

Best Time to Visit

April-June and September-October for mild weather and fewer tourists.

Local Tips

Most shops and restaurants close during midday for a few hours. Explore local trattorias for authentic regional cuisine at reasonable prices. A car or bicycle is handy for visiting nearby villages and countryside.

Cultural Etiquette

It's customary to greet with a friendly 'Buongiorno' at shops. Tipping is not obligatory but appreciated (round up the bill). Dress modestly when visiting churches, and avoid loud or disruptive behavior in public spaces.

Safety Warnings

Pianiga is very safe with low crime; however, exercise usual caution with valuables at the train station. Few streetlights in rural areas, carry a flashlight if walking late.

Hidden Gems

Visit the 19th-century Parish Church in the center, cycle along the scenic Brenta riverbanks, and explore local agrotourism farms (agriturismi) for farm-to-table experiences.
